Police: Veteran ambushed, killed as he opened garage door

According to DeKalb Co. Police, a homeowner was shot and killed during an ambush in the 500 block of Mountain Oaks Parkway, Stone Mountain.

The incident was called into DeKalb PD at 6:00 this morning.

A man was about to take his wife to work when they opened the garage door and three men were waiting for them outside. They ambushed the couple and killed the husband during the struggle. According to police, nothing was taken.

The victim's wife proceeded to run to a neighbors house to call 9-1-1.

The victim was identified as 47-year-old Phillip Lamar Davis.

Daphne Sinclarr, who told 11Alive that she was the sister of the wife, said that she was contacted by the wife before she called 9-1-1. "My sister lives a good life. Clean. She works everyday so I'm not sure exactly what's going on."

The suspects are still on the loose and investigators are interviewing witnesses. According to DeKalb PD, the neighborhood has a "very strong home owner's association" and this type of activity does not normally occur there.
